Healthy Shepherds Pie

A new twist on an old favorite. Using mashed cauliflower in lieu of potatoes.

Ingredients

  • 1 lb lean ground turkey
  • 1 cup corn
  • 1 cup green peas
  • 1 cup carrots ( sliced)
  • 1 cup  celery (chopped)
  • 1 sm  yellow onion (dice)
  • himalayan salt & black pepper
  • 1 tsp dried thyme
  • 1/2 tsp dried rosemary
  • 1 1/2 tsps Worcestershire sauce

Topping Ingredients

  • 1 large cauliflower
  • sea salt & black pepper
  • 1 chopped  yellow onion
  • 1 Tbsp minced garlic
  • 1/2 cup plain greek yogurt

Directions for Topping

  • Wash and chop cauliflower into small pieces.
  • Place cauliflower into a steamer and steam until soft.
  • Place steamed cauliflower, onion, garlic, greek yogurt and salt & pepper, in a food processor and process until smooth.
  • Set aside.

Directions

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• In a large frying pan, brown ground turkey until no longer pink.
  • Once cooked, add carrots, celery, onions, and spices and cook until softened.
  • Stir in peas & carrots.
  • Add turkey mixture to an ovenproof casserole dish.
  • Spoon the mashed cauliflower over top.
  • Spread with a fork to fully cover the turkey mixture.
  • Sprinkle with more salt & pepper.
  • Place in the oven for 25 minutes or until cauliflower starts to brown.
  • Remove from oven.
  • Enjoy!

 

Serves 6 – per serving – 221 Calories, 24gr Carbs, 4gr Fat, 24gr Protein, 9gr Sugar, 7gr Fiber
